'Know Your Schools' in Arlington on Feb. 8
January 30, 2012 · 4:36 PM
ARLINGTON — The Arlington Public Schools will be hosting their second "Know Your Schools" event for members of the community on Wednesday, Feb. 8, from 8:30-11:30 a.m.
Community members are invited to meet in the Arlington School District Board of Directors' office, located at 315 N. French Ave., at 8:30 a.m. for a complimentary continental breakfast with ASD Superintendent Dr. Kristine McDuffy.
Attendees will be able to hear about the learning occurring in the schools, and after the informational session, there will be a tour of a few schools to see student achievement in real time.
"We would like you to see firsthand some of our successes, challenges and opportunities," ASD Public Information Officer Andrea Conley said.
